Latest Patents

Richter-Trummer's latest patents include a "Movable joining device for connecting structural components of an aircraft." This device features joining means that are moveably arranged on a guiding device located on the exterior of the structural components. It is designed to fixedly connect joining edges of adjacent structural components. The joining means includes a welding unit that can move along a rail-like guiding device and is equipped with a specialized bobbin tool for friction stir welding. Another significant patent is the "Joining apparatus for joining structural components of an aircraft." This apparatus includes positioning means that hold the structural components in a defined position, allowing for fixed joining through a movable joining device. The positioning means consist of a formative frame structure that is detachably secured to the structural components along the joining edges.
